When reading threads like this one, I think it's important to remember that it is a very emotional subject, making it much easier to misunderstand each other. What some persons feel is inappropriate is not necessarily intended that way by the one who wrote it.
Every euthanasia decision is an individual situation, even if/when it on the surface might seem like identical situations, the right decision for one horse, might still be wrong at another time with another horse.

Life for a pet isn't only about living more days, it's about the quality of life on those days. It's so tempting when you love your pet to want to try to get a few more days with them, that is why I find it admirable when someone can notice that things are going downhill for 2 bonded horses, and decide to let them go together.

When they retired Carl built new stables just for them, they had their own retirement suite, just the two of them nearer the house and away from the main yard to give them peace and quiet. Anyone whose been on a yard tour will have seen it, its also been on camera as Carl has given several interviews etc by their new stables.
